For those who prefer mineral sunscreens, she advises finding one that won’t leave behind a white cast, which won’t harm a tan, but will impact your tan’s appearance. Some of Peek’s clients opt for sunscreens with added self-tanner or bronzer to help them maintain their faux glow for as long as possible. Shirazi notes, “Alcohol based products, especially if listed amongst the first ingredients - alcohol denat - can shorten your spray tan’s lifespan.”Īnd according to Natalia Radosz, founder of Glow2Go in New York City, a buzzword to watch out for is “quick-drying.” Rodosz adds, “If it is quick dry, it probably has a high alcohol content.” Formulas You’ll also want to avoid aerosolized, alcohol-based sunscreens. Shirazi says to look for a sunscreen with “hydrating and nourishing ingredients like glycerin, aloe vera, niacinamide, shea butter, vitamin E, and hyaluronic acid.” To ensure that you’re getting a sunscreen that will not only protect your skin but also locks in moisture, Dr. Azadeh Shirazi, who adds that you’ll want to “opt for a lotion or cream-based sunscreen as opposed to an aerosol spray to better hydrate the skin and prolong your spray tan.” What To Consider When Shopping For The Best Sunscreens For Spray Tans Ingredients In addition, you’ll want to look for a broad-spectrum SPF that’s free of oils and alcohol, according to board-certified dermatologist Dr. Hydration is key because skin that’s properly moisturized will maintain the life of its tan for longer, so naturally, the best sunscreens for spray tans are loaded with moisturizing and hydrating ingredients. To keep your spray tan looking great for as long as possible, all the products you use, including sunscreen, should provide plenty of moisture, according to Bondi Sands Chief Marketing Officer Alexandra Peek.
